Professional Repair vs DIY Repairs

Many homeowners try fixing appliances themselves with videos and replacement parts ordered online. While that works for simple tasks like changing a dryer belt on an older unit, most modern repairs involve risks that outweigh the savings in Alamo homes.

Electricity, gas lines, and water connections hide dangers. One wrong move with a live wire or open gas valve can create fire hazards or flooding that damages floors and walls in ranch style Alamo homes with spacious layouts. Water leaks from a misconnected dishwasher hose travel fast under cabinets and into neighboring rooms on these larger lots.

Fragile components like control boards, sensors, and sealed compressors break easily when handled without proper tools or experience. Swapping the wrong part often leads to misdiagnosis and repeated failures that cost more in the long run. Newer appliances use electronic interfaces that need specific programming sequences after replacement and work best in the climate of the East Bay.

Local Contra Costa County homes see heavy use from families and commuters on Highway 680. DIY attempts on a refrigerator or oven can leave the unit unsafe or create issues with future service. Professional repair brings the right diagnostic equipment, factory level knowledge, and experience with the exact models common in these San Ramon Valley neighborhoods.

Safety around children and pets matters too. Gas dryers or ranges need pressure tests and leak checks that homeowners rarely have the tools for. We handle every step so your home stays protected and the repair lasts through daily East Bay life in Alamo and surrounding areas.

Why is my appliance leaking?

Leaking usually comes from clogged drains, worn hoses, failed seals, or loose connections. During the visit we trace the exact source, whether water from a dishwasher, condensation from a refrigerator, or a supply line issue, and fix it properly the first time.

What should I do before the technician arrives?

Unplug the appliance if safe, clear space around it, and gather any error codes or unusual sounds you noticed. For gas units leave the shutoff valve accessible and keep pets and children in another room. This helps us start diagnostics right away in your Alamo home.
